The Macallan 15 Year Old Double Cask 70cl is a premium single malt Scotch whisky that beautifully balances tradition and innovation. Matured for 15 years in a perfect harmony of American oak seasoned with sherry and European oak casks, this expression delivers a rich and complex character that showcases Macallan’s signature craftsmanship.
This whisky is part of the renowned Macallan Double Cask Collection, celebrated for its smooth and warm profile with notes of vanilla, honey, and dried fruits. 🍯 Tasting Notes
-
Nose: Warm aromas of dried fruits, vanilla, citrus zest, and soft butterscotch.
-
Palate: Creamy and balanced with honey, chocolate, raisins, and a touch of oak spice.
-
Finish: Long, warming finish with subtle cinnamon, nutmeg, and toasted oak.
